The Hidden Dangers of Overstocking an Aquarium
When human beings take a look at an aquarium, they frequently judge capacity based on empty visual space. They might see a 20-gallon tank with five fish and think, "There's plenty of room left! Let's add ten more."
Sadly, fish do not live by visual area alone. Overstocking results in numerous critical issues:
- Ammonia Spikes: Fish continuously produce waste through their gills, feces, and decomposing leftover food. This waste breaks down into poisonous ammonia. In an overstocked tank, the helpful germs can not process the waste quick enough, leading to deadly ammonia poisoning.
- Oxygen Depletion: Fish, plants, and helpful germs all take in oxygen. More fish suggest higher oxygen usage, resulting in suffocation, particularly at night when plants stop producing oxygen through photosynthesis.
- Worried Behavior: Cramped quarters cause aggressiveness. Territorial fish will end up being extremely protective, nipping fins and triggering persistent stress, which reduces their body immune systems and makes them vulnerable to diseases like Ich.
- Stunted Growth: In overcrowded environments, hormonal agents are released into the water that physically stunt the growth of fish, leading to organ failure and shortened lifespans.
What is a "How Many Fish Calculator"?
A How Many Fish Calculator is a digital tool designed to help aquarium owners determine the maximum safe equipping capability of their tank. By inputting particular variables about the aquarium setup and the wanted types, the calculator produces a projected percentage of how "full" the tank is.
Most precise calculators exceed basic guesswork and consider numerous clinical variables:
- Tank Dimensions and Volume: The surface area of the water is often more crucial than total gallons because gas exchange occurs at the surface area.
- Purification Capacity: A high-end container filter can deal with a heavier bioload than a basic hang-on-back (HOB) filter.
- Fish Adult Size: Juveniles grow up. A calculator takes a look at the maximum size of the fish, not its current size at the pet store.
- Fish Temperament and Activity Level: An active education fish that swims continuously (like a Danio) needs more oxygen and space than a sedentary bottom-dweller (like a Cory Catfish).
The Evolution of Stocking Rules: Beyond the "1 Inch per Gallon" Myth
For years, the principle of aquarium equipping was easy: 1 inch of fish per 1 gallon of water.
While easy to remember, this guideline is precariously out-of-date. Consider the following flaws:
- A 10-inch Oscar can not reside in a 10-gallon tank, despite the fact that it fulfills the mathematical requirement, due to the fact that it can not even turn around.
- A 2-inch Goldfish produces vastly more waste than a 2-inch Neon Tetra due to its digestive system.
Modern calculators utilize intricate algorithms that replace the 1-inch rule with bioload evaluations and surface-area-to-volume ratios.
How to Use a How Many Fish Calculator Effectively
To get the most precise outcomes from a fish calculator, users must gather exact data before entering it into the tool. Follow these actions for success:
- Step 1: Determine True Water Volume. Remember that substrate, decorations, and driftwood take up water displacement. A 50-gallon tank generally just holds about 40 to 45 gallons of real water.
- Step 2: Rate the Filtration. Be honest about the filter type. If the filter is rated for a smaller sized tank, input that lower ability.
- Action 3: Research Adult Sizes. Look up the maximum length of every types meant for the tank.
- Step 4: Check Compatibility. A calculator measures biological capacity, not behavioral compatibility. It will not alert if a Cichlid will eat a shrimp, so research types personalities individually.
